J U D G M E N T
The petitioner, who was appointed as an L.D. Clerk in Azhikode High School with effect from 22.2.2010, against a retirement vacancy, is aggrieved by the approval that was granted to the appointment, on daily wages with effect from 22.2.2010 to 31.5.2010 and on a scale of pay basis from 1.6.2010 onwards. It is the case of the petitioner that the appointment should have been approved on a regular basis from 22.2.2010 itself. In connection with the said grievance, the petitioner has preferred Ext.P6 representation before the 2nd respondent. The limited prayer of the petitioner in the writ petition is for a direction to the 2nd respondent to consider and pass orders on the said representation, within a stipulated time frame, after hearing the petitioner.
2. I have heard the learned counsel for the petitioner as also the learned Government Pleader for the respondents.
W.P.(C).No.18781/2015 On a consideration of the facts and circumstances of the case as also the submissions made across the bar, I dispose the writ petition with a direction to the 2nd respondent to consider and pass orders on Ext.P6 representation, preferred by the petitioner, within a period of two months from the date of receipt of a copy of this judgment, after hearing the petitioner. The petitioner shall produce a copy of the writ petition as also a copy of this judgment before the 2nd respondent, for further action.
